Skip to main content

Python api wrapper for loading.se

Project description

Python Loading SDK

PyPI Version Build Status

Install

pip install python-loading-sdk

Usage

Instantiate the client and optionally provide login credentials to be able to use methods that requires the user to be logged in.

from loading_sdk import LoadingApiClient

client = LoadingApiClient(email="your@email.com", password="your_password")

response = client.get_profile()

It can also be used asyncrounously usage:

from loading_sdk import AsyncLoadingApiClient

client = await AsyncLoadingApiClient(email="your@email.com", password="your_password")

response = await client.get_profile()

Examples

Requires Auth

response = client.get_profile()
response = client.create_post(thread_id="5bbb986af1deda001d33bc4b", message="My message!")
response = client.edit_post(post_id="5bc876dd70a79c001dab7ebe", message="My updated message!")
response = client.create_thread(title="My title", message="The content!", category_name="games")
response = client.edit_thread(post_id="5bbb986af1deda001d33bc4b", message="My updated message!")

Anonymous

response = client.search(query="search query")
response = client.get_post(post_id="5bc876dd70a79c001dab7ebe")
response = client.get_thread(thread_id="5bbb986af1deda001d33bc4b", page=3)
response = client.get_games(page=5)
response = client.get_other(page=7)
response = client.get_editorials(page=2, post_type="review", sort="title")

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

python-loading-sdk-0.2.1.tar.gz (43.5 kB view details)

Uploaded Source

Built Distribution

python_loading_sdk-0.2.1-py3-none-any.whl (46.3 kB view details)

Uploaded Python 3

File details

Details for the file python-loading-sdk-0.2.1.tar.gz.

File metadata

  • Download URL: python-loading-sdk-0.2.1.tar.gz
  • Upload date:
  • Size: 43.5 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: poetry/1.2.0 CPython/3.10.6 Linux/5.15.0-1017-azure

File hashes

Hashes for python-loading-sdk-0.2.1.tar.gz
Algorithm Hash digest
SHA256 f77e3f32ec63e7c1b4afd9dec5af8ac5f9db10a3568142b2a0961e70a7b9da70
MD5 cca4d5ab7db5a72d1c6f4171e4048c7a
BLAKE2b-256 f839253335f4702368043c3e1c9d1d4e2a3637ab895fd14e81af711fa3b5a49c

See more details on using hashes here.

File details

Details for the file python_loading_sdk-0.2.1-py3-none-any.whl.

File metadata

  • Download URL: python_loading_sdk-0.2.1-py3-none-any.whl
  • Upload date:
  • Size: 46.3 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: poetry/1.2.0 CPython/3.10.6 Linux/5.15.0-1017-azure

File hashes

Hashes for python_loading_sdk-0.2.1-py3-none-any.whl
Algorithm Hash digest
SHA256 04818b160dfcb1f89409529d43e7c9738561a2e836a11a8f07c72369f6de0dfd
MD5 a6d8004303fabf1d327f2aedc6945a51
BLAKE2b-256 1f96ecc9488677ff88391a773a0e425803024cd31642fb06c9c9c254aabf0264

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page